Daylight assault on elderly woman

South Western Times

Police have appealed for assistance from anyone who may have witnessed the robbery of an 80-year-old woman in Bunbury on Tuesday.

The Bunbury woman had parked her car in angle parking in Stephen Street at 9.30 am when she realised she had left something in the car.

As she reached into the car through the passenger side door, she was pushed from behind, injuring herself as she fell into the car.

Her bag was snatched from her shoulder as she fell.

When she stood back up she found her bag had been dropped on the footpath and her purse, containing a quantity of cash, stolen from inside it.

Police urge anyone who may have seen the incident or have any information as to those might be responsible for this cowardly attack on a vulnerable woman, to please call Crime Stoppers on 1800 333 000.
